Description
EJP start delay
– Delay between the EJP start signal and the
actual start signal at the generator.
EJP changeover delay
– Delay in changing over the load from the
priority to the secondary line in the EJP and
SCR mode.
Locking of the EJP return changeover
– If set to ON, the load in the modes EJP, EJP-
T and SCR is not switched back to the priority
line when a fault occurs in the generator, but
only when the signals at the EJP inputs enable
the changeover.
– When this parameter is enabled and the
switching device does not close successfully
(no feedback on presence of opening com-
mand), not only the corresponding feedback
alarm (A03 or A04) is triggered, but changeover
to the secondary line is also controlled.
OFF = Function disabled
1 = Check Line 1
2 = Check Line 2
1+2 = Check both lines.
Duration of the opening pulse of the undervolt-
age release for the opening of the switching
devices
– If an additional undervoltage release is used,
this parameter defines how long the output is
opened with the undervoltage release function
Line 1 or 2 (see chapter Table of functions of
the digital outputs (Page 112))
Delay between opening pulse of the undervolt-
age release and spring reload command
– This parameter defines after which time (after
parameter P05.18 has elapsed) an opening
command to load the springs is sent to the
switching device.
